WebVery little light from the surface penetrates between 200 and 1,000 meters, in what’s known as the dysphotic or twilight zone. Once we reach about 1,000 meters depth, light from above has disappeared entirely. This sunless realm is known as the aphotic zone. Light conditions affect how much both humans and organisms see. WebPenetration depthis a measure of how deep light or any electromagnetic radiationcan penetrate into a material. It is defined as the depth at which the intensity of the radiation inside the material falls to 1/e(about 37%) of its original value at (or more properly, just beneath) the surface.
